Precisely what is a Aid Coordinator?
A Assistance Coordinator is a specialist who helps NDIS contributors in comprehending and using their NDIS options. They assist contributors connect with services companies, coordinate a variety of supports, and Make the potential to deal with their very own supports independently. The ultimate goal is usually to empower members for making educated selections and realize their own plans.

Levels of Assist Coordination
The NDIS acknowledges a few amounts of support coordination, Each and every catering to unique participant requires:
Support Connection: This degree focuses on constructing the participant's capacity to hook up with casual, Local community, and funded supports, enabling them to find the most out in their approach.
Support Coordination: At this level, the Support Coordinator assists in designing and implementing a mixture of supports, helping the participant to live much more independently and be A part of the Group.
Expert Guidance Coordination: This is certainly for members with additional advanced demands. Expert Help Coordinators aid handle difficulties within the support environment and be certain reliable provider shipping.
